Individual Obstacles (IO) are part of the Group Testing Officer (GTO) tasks where candidates are required to complete a set of physical challenges within a given time. Purpose of Individual Obstacles: Understanding Individual Obstacles in SSB Interview is essential to perform well during the GTO tasks. List of Individual Obstacles in SSB Interview 1. Commando Walk This obstacle involves walking across ropes, beams, and bars at a height. Tests: 2. Double Ditch Candidates must jump across two ditches without touching the ground. Tests: 3. Tarzan Swing A rope swing is used to cross from one platform to another. Tests: 4. Monkey Crawl Candidates crawl under low structures like nets and ropes. Tests: 5. Zig-Zag Balance Walking on a narrow zig-zag beam at a height. Tests: 6. Burma Bridge A rope bridge that requires careful balance and movement. Tests: 7. Tarzan Jump Jumping from a platform to grab a rope and swing forward. Tests: 8. Tyre Obstacle Moving through suspended tyres placed in a sequence. Tests: 9. 6-Foot Wall Jump Candidates must climb or jump over a 6-foot wall. Tests: 10. Snake Race Crawling through a narrow path simulating battlefield conditions. Tests: 11. Balance Beam Walking on a straight elevated beam. Tests: 12. Vertical Rope Climbing Climbing a rope using upper body strength. For candidates preparing at GAPS SSB, mastering the group planning exercise ssb is essential to perform confidently in the GTO series. What is Group Planning Exercise in SSB? The group planning exercise is an indoor task conducted by the Group Testing Officer (GTO). Candidates are seated in a horseshoe formation, and a map or model is placed in front of them. In the group planning exercise ssb, candidates are given a story that includes multiple problems. They must analyze the situation, prioritize issues, and create a practical plan using available resources. Procedure of Group Planning Exercise (GPE) The group planning exercise (GPE) is conducted in the following stages: 1. Introduction by GTO The GTO explains the map/model in detail, including roads, distances, landmarks, and resources. 2. Story Narration A situation is narrated involving multiple problems like accidents, crimes, or emergencies. 3. Reading Time Candidates get 5 minutes to read the story carefully. 4. Individual Planning Candidates are given 10 minutes to write their individual solutions. 5. Group Discussion Candidates discuss for 15–20 minutes to reach a common plan. 6. Final Narration One candidate presents the final group plan. This entire process of the group planning exercise ssb checks your ability to think and act under pressure. The THEMATIC APPERCEPTION TEST (TAT) is a psychological test where candidates are shown a series of pictures and asked to write a story based on each image. Key Features of TAT The THEMATIC APPERCEPTION TEST for SSB interview is designed to evaluate how you perceive situations and respond to challenges. Structure of a TAT Story A good story in the THEMATIC APPERCEPTION TEST should have three main parts: 1. Background 2. Present Situation 3. Outcome This structure helps psychologists understand your thought process and personality traits. Important Rules for Writing TAT Stories To perform well in the THEMATIC APPERCEPTION TEST for SSB interview, follow these essential guidelines: Write in Past Tense Always write your story in past tense to show that action has already been taken. Create a Realistic Hero Focus on Problem-Solving Show Leadership and Teamwork Keep the Story Positive Common Mistakes in THEMATIC APPERCEPTION TEST Many candidates make avoidable mistakes in the THEMATIC APPERCEPTION TEST, which leads to poor evaluation. Major Mistakes Avoiding these mistakes can significantly improve your performance. THEMATIC APPERCEPTION TEST Example Let’s understand with a simple THEMATIC APPERCEPTION TEST Example: Example Story Rahul was a college student who was going to attend his classes. On the way, he noticed a road accident where a person was lying injured and no one was helping him. Rahul quickly assessed the situation and asked nearby people to assist him. He arranged a vehicle and took the injured person to the hospital. He informed the victim’s family using his mobile phone and ensured proper medical treatment. After confirming the patient was stable, Rahul continued with his day and later followed up on his recovery. Analysis of the Story This THEMATIC APPERCEPTION TEST Example shows: Such stories reflect strong Officer-Like Qualities.
